Data saturation is a situation that occurs in qualitative research when a. data collection stops when no new information is obta
Shalnov [3]

Answer:  Option(a) is correct option

Explanation:

In terms of qualitative research, data saturation is signified through enough quantity and quantity of data information for repetition. When no new information is seen in data then it is saturation point where repetition of data takes place.New data gathering stops in such case.

Other options are incorrect because data saturation is not seen when special data analysis method is used, for elimination of data that has been repeated more than three times and number of participants are more than required .Thus, the correct option is option(a).
